After doing well they had to go back to give it another go. Had grass shrimp for crackers, worms and minnows for whatever was biting. Hit the pads and wernt doing very well but moved closer to where others boats were.
Got advice on how to present shrimp with no weight and started ketchn some. Picked up some smaller ones before hitting a couple Toads.
Moved to different area and got into some good size specs. Caught some gills too and had another real nice day.
Seems to be a good place to go. Several boatloads of guys with cane poles were really ketchn the crackers.

Seems like good shellcracker population and they are ketchn them plus some good sized specs as well and you don't have to go a long ways to get them. advise to bring a pole along as the pads are in 5 to 8 fow and much easier to get around that way instead of TM at least it worked best for us.
